
Here’s a great recipe with mushrooms to have in your locker for busy nights.
Step 1
Clean the portobello mushrooms and remove the stems. Set aside.
Step 2
In a small bowl, mix the ginger, teriyaki sauce, and honey. Set aside.
Step 3
Heat the sesame o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the garlic and portobellos, and cook for 8–10 minutes, turning them, until tender.
Step 4--Reduce the heat, add the sauce to the skillet, and gently coat the portobellos. Cook for 2–3 more minutes until the sauce thickens.
Step 5
Heat the Mahatma® Ready to Heat Teriyaki Fried Rice in the microwave for 90 seconds and mix it with the spinach. Stuff each portobello with the teriyaki rice and spinach, place them on a plate, and garnish with a black and white toasted sesame seed mix.
